6 Exercises To Strengthen The Cervical Muscles

Exercises to strengthen the cervical muscles do not have to be very intense. If we execute them, it is advisable not to overwork. Otherwise, this region will deteriorate further.
6 exercises to strengthen the cervical muscles

Did you know that in order to prevent overload and accumulation of tension, it is good to adopt a daily exercise routine to strengthen the cervical muscles? Stretching exercises and other similar activities improve the elasticity of this region and increase muscle mass.

The cervical region is among the parts of the body most susceptible to the accumulation of tension. Discomfort in the cervical muscles is one of the main reasons why patients report pain.

In today’s article we propose some exercises for strengthening the cervical muscles and we present the benefits of keeping this region in shape.

The main benefits of strengthening the cervical muscles

If your cervical muscles are strong, it is easier for you to maintain a proper body posture. In addition to being connected to the spine, these muscles have a set of nerves that are negatively affected by lack of physical activity.

You will no longer have problems with balance

Basic motor movements, whose role is dynamic balance, are impossible in the absence of adequate physical activity. By keeping these muscles in optimal condition, you will avoid cervical vertigo.

Breath quality will increase

Optimal cervical flexibility is essential to breathe effectively, especially when you exercise.

The muscles responsible for breathing contract during training and, if we do not keep them in shape, we risk injury. In addition, these injuries cause a problem we all know: neck pain.

Get rid of stress

The following exercises for strengthening the cervical muscles help to release the tension caused by daily life. Performing a toning session can help you improve the stiffness of the neck and relax the affected muscles.

What are the best exercises for strengthening the cervical muscles?

It is important to keep the cervical muscles as flexible as possible. For this purpose, we need an exercise routine that increases muscle tone. Such training will prevent or improve debilitating contracts.

The 6 exercises for strengthening the cervical muscles will keep this region flexible. Start with a short warm-up:

Exercise no. 1: Stretching forward

  • Sit down upright, looking straight ahead.
  • Put your hands on your forehead and press it, simultaneously pushing your head forward.
  • Perform 10 repetitions.

Exercise no. 2: Lateral extensions

  • Put one hand on one of the temples and press your head, simultaneously tilting it towards the corresponding shoulder.
  • Tilt your head until your ear touches your shoulder.
  • Train the other side as well.
  • Perform 5 repetitions.

After this warm-up, perform the following exercises:

Exercise no. 3

  • Tilt your head forward until you feel your neck stretched.
  • Hold this position for 5 seconds.
  • Then repeat the exercise, this time leaving your head back as far as you can. Hold the position for 5 seconds.
  • Rest for 10 seconds.
  • Perform 5 repetitions.

Exercise no. 4

  • Turn your head to one side, as if you want to look at your shoulder.
  • Slightly return to starting position.
  • Turn your head in the opposite direction to the original.
  • Perform 10 repetitions.

Exercise no. 5

  • Tilt your head forward carefully.
  • Turn your head slightly to the left, make a circular motion to turn it to the right, then return to the starting position.
  • Rest for 5 seconds.
  • Repeat the exercise, this time starting with the opposite side.
  • Perform 5 repetitions on both sides.

Exercise no. 6

  • Without moving your head, lift your shoulders as if you want to touch your ears with them.
  • Hold this position for 5 seconds.
  • Then lower your shoulders as much as you can.
  • Hold the position for 5 seconds.
  • Perform 10 repetitions.

Remember, these exercises to strengthen the cervical muscles must be performed carefully, without rushing. Violent movements can cause pain. To have a pain-free life, it is essential to have a strong neck.

Wrong body postures, excessive sitting in front of the computer, sleeping on pillows that are too soft and the accumulation of stress can cause problems in the cervical muscles.

  • Take a well-deserved break and free your mind from daily worries.
  • Include short walks in your daily routine.
  • Adopt relaxation techniques, such as deep breathing exercises, so that you keep stress under control.
